FROM ubuntu:18.04 # We manually create users for postgres, to make 100% sure that the # postgres user gets UID 101. Without this, the UIDs are dependent on # the order in which apt-get install them and redis could get UID 101. # The GIDs are arbitrary, and chosen such that they match the situation # from before we installed redis. Since Postgres files are stored in a # volume, a change in UID/GID would prevent Postgres from starting.
